Does folic acid boost fertility? This question has been on the minds of many couples struggling to conceive. Folic acid, also known as vitamin B9, is a vital nutrient that plays a crucial role in various bodily functions, including fertility. In this article, we will explore the relationship between folic acid and fertility, and whether it can indeed help boost a couple’s chances of conception.

Folic acid is essential for the production of DNA and RNA, which are the building blocks of cells. It is particularly important for women of childbearing age, as it helps prevent neural tube defects in developing fetuses. However, recent studies have suggested that folic acid may also have a positive impact on fertility.

One study published in the “Journal of Fertility and Sterility” found that women who took folic acid supplements for at least three months before conception had a 40% lower risk of ovulatory infertility compared to those who did not take supplements. Ovulatory infertility occurs when a woman does not ovulate regularly, which can be caused by various factors, including hormonal imbalances.

Another study, conducted by researchers at the University of Adelaide, Australia, revealed that folic acid can improve the quality of sperm in men. The study showed that men who took folic acid supplements for 12 weeks had a higher sperm count and better sperm motility than those who did not take the supplements.

The exact mechanism by which folic acid boosts fertility is not yet fully understood. However, it is believed that folic acid may help improve the health of reproductive cells by reducing oxidative stress and inflammation, which can damage sperm and egg cells. Additionally, folic acid may play a role in regulating the menstrual cycle and improving egg quality.

While folic acid supplements can be beneficial for fertility, it is important to note that they should not be used as a substitute for medical treatment. Couples experiencing fertility issues should consult with a healthcare professional to determine the underlying cause and receive appropriate treatment.
